Background
The stethoscope is a diagnostic tool commonly used in medicine, and a doctor can use the stethoscope to hear various sounds in a patient's body, such as heartbeat sound, respiration sound, sounds generated during gastrointestinal digestion, and the like, from the outside of the body, and can make a preliminary diagnosis of the patient's condition, so that the function of the stethoscope is very important.
The conventional stethoscopes have a simple structure, and the principle thereof is to transmit sound by vibration of a substance, with the progress of the technology, the stethoscopes of today have been advanced and developed, and modern stethoscopes such as electronic stethoscopes, digital stethoscopes, etc. have appeared accordingly, even the 5G technology which is currently advanced is also applied to the stethoscopes.
Although these modern stethoscopes have many advantages, they inevitably have special situations such as electronic failure and insufficient electric energy, and once these situations occur, they cannot be used, and the reliability needs to be improved.

Referring to the attached drawings 1-4 of the specification, the noise reduction type 5G digital stethoscope comprises a stethoscope head 1, a conduit 2 and two earrings 3, wherein the stethoscope head 1, the conduit 2 and the earrings 3 jointly form a stethoscope main body, the stethoscope head 1 is fixedly arranged at one end of the conduit 2, the stethoscope head 1 collects sound, the other end of the conduit 2 is connected with the two earrings 3 through a three-way pipe, a mute box 4 is arranged at one end of each earring 3, a sealing plate 13 is arranged on one side of each mute box 4, one end of each earring 3 penetrates through the sealing plate 13 and extends into the mute box 4, a connecting ring 11 is fixedly arranged on one side of the sealing plate 13, the connecting ring 11 is arranged inside the mute box 4, the outer end of the connecting ring 11 is connected with the inner wall of the mute box 4 through threads, the mute box 4 is closed, a connecting wire 5 is arranged outside the mute box 4, one end of the connecting wire 5 extends into the mute box 4 and is fixedly provided with a microphone 9, the microphone 9 converts sound signals at the earrings 3 into electric signals, a rubber ring 12 is fixed on the sealing plate 13, the inner side of the mute box 4 is provided with a rubber ring 12, and the noise reduction cotton is arranged on the noise reduction effect of noise reduction.
4 one side of silence box is equipped with control box 6, the inside circuit board 14 that is equipped with of control box 6, two the 5 other ends of connecting wire all extend to control box 6 inside and be connected with circuit board 14, carry the signal of telecommunication to circuit board 14, be equipped with earphone 8 on the control box 6, 8 one end of earphone extends to control box 6 inside and is connected with circuit board 14, utilizes earphone 8 to listen to sound, 6 tops of control box are equipped with top cap 7 and are connected through the screw with top cap 7, 7 fixed a plurality of buttons that are equipped with in top cap, button and 14 electric connection of circuit board to this is controlled circuit board 14.
The implementation scenario is specifically as follows: when the stethoscope is used, the ear cups 8 are placed in the ears, then the stethoscope head 1 is placed at a corresponding position outside the body of a patient, at this time, the sound in the body of the patient is transmitted to the ear rings 3 through the stethoscope head 1 and the tubes 2, one ends of the two ear rings 3 are both located in the sound box 4, and the microphone 9 is arranged inside the sound box 4, so that the sound emitted by the ear rings 3 is converted into an electric signal through the microphone 9 and enters the circuit board 14 inside the control box 6 along the connecting line 5, the earphone 8 is connected with the circuit board 14, the electric signal at the circuit board 14 is transmitted to the earphone 8 and then is played again after being converted into a sound signal, so that the sound in the body of the patient can be heard, when the stethoscope cannot be used normally due to failure of electrical components such as the earphone 8, the microphone 9 or the circuit board 14 inside the control box 6 or other reasons, the two ear rings 3 can be pulled out of the sound box 4, and the stethoscope body composed of the stethoscope head 1, the tubes 2 and the ear rings 3 can be used as a stethoscope without affecting the emergency function of the conventional electronic equipment.
Referring to fig. 1-5 of the specification, in the noise reduction type 5G digital stethoscope according to the embodiment, the circuit board 14 is fixedly provided with the filter 18, the filter 18 is electrically connected to the microphone 9, the filter 18 can eliminate noise inside sound, the circuit board 14 is fixedly provided with the memory card 15, the 5G transmission module 16 and the bluetooth module 17, the memory card 15 can store collected sound signals therein, the 5G transmission module 16 can automatically initiate access with a base station and establish heartbeat service with a background server, and the stethoscope is wirelessly connected with a mobile phone or other devices through the bluetooth module 17.
The implementation scenario is specifically as follows: the circuit board 14 is fixed with a memory card 15, a 5G transmission module 16, a Bluetooth module 17 and a filter 18, in the using process of the stethoscope, the memory card 15 can store the collected sound signals therein, so that doctors can repeatedly play at any time as required, the 5G transmission module 16 can automatically initiate access with a base station, and establish heartbeat service with a background server, so that the 5G transmission module 16 is always in a connected state, when data is generated, the data can be generated and sent to the background server in real time, the use is more convenient, before the use, the stethoscope can be wirelessly connected with a mobile phone or other equipment through the Bluetooth module 17, the sound collected by the stethoscope can be analyzed through related equipment, the analyzed data can provide help for the diagnosis of the doctors, the filter 18 is electrically connected with the microphone 9, the microphone 9 converts the sound signals into electric signals, in the process, the filter 18 can eliminate the noise inside the sound, and reduce the noise, and avoid the noise from interfering the diagnosis of the doctors.
